Filename Conventions and Compatibility

WINDOWS CONVENTIONS
Windows has a maximum PATH length of 260 characters, so that includes
the drive letter (+ colon and backslash) folder and sub-folder names and
back-slashes.
Under Windows using the NTFS file system file and folder names may be up
to 256 characters long.
The following characters are invalid as file or folder names on Windows
using NTFS:
/ ? < > \ : * | " and any character you can type with the Ctrl key.
In addition to the above illegal characters the caret ^ is also not
permitted under Windows Operating Systems using the FAT file system.
In addition to these characters, the following conventions are also illegal:
Placing a space at the end of the name
Placing a period at the end of the name
The following file names are also reserved under Windows:
com1, com2, com3, com4, com5, com6, com7, com8, com9, lpt1, lpt2,
lpt3, lpt4, lpt5, lpt6, lpt7, lpt8, lpt9, con, nul, and prn
MACINTOSH OS 9 CONVENTIONS
The only illegal character for file and folder names in Mac OS 9 is the
colon ":"
File and folder names may be up to 31 characters in length
MACINTOSH OS X CONVENTIONS
Since Mac OS X is build on top of UNIX there are a few inherent
conventions that OS 9 users may not expect. Because of this, migrating
certain files and folders from OS 9 to OS X may cause unexpected behavior.
The only illegal character for file and folder names in Mac OS X is the
colon ":"
File and folder names are not permitted to begin with a dot "."
File and folder names may be up to 151 characters in length
UNIX CONVENTIONS
A file name can be up to 255 characters long. This restriction is a
file name restriction not a path name length restriction.
A file name can contain any character at all with the exception of
slash ("/") which is used as a path name component separator and NUL (a
character with all bits set to zero) which is used internally as a file
name terminator. Thus a file name could consist entirely of space and
back space characters.
All characters are significant. In other words the Unix file naming
system is case sensitive. Lower case file names are more common than
upper case file names.
File names do not have components or extensions. You can have as many
dots as you like (up to 255 !) in a Unix file name. Many applications,
however, regard the part of a file name after the last dot as having
special significance.
As any freshly created directory will contain entries "." and ".." (dot and
dot-dot referring to the current directory and the parent directory,
files cannot be named "." and ".."
WEB CONVENTIONS
All filenames in URI's should conform to RFC 1630 (no spaces, necessary to escape characters etc.)

    You will get that first message when the document has been changed in a way that invalidates the internal digital signature that's applied when a document is Reader-enabled. Certain changes are allowed (e.g., filling fields, commenting, signing) and will not invalidate the signature, but others are not. The exact cause of the change is often hard to track down, but it can be due to font problems, some type of file corruption, or something that Acrobat/Reader attempts to correct when the file is opened/saved. You will also get the message if the users system time is not correct and is currently set to some time before the document was Reader-enabled. It seems best to use the most recent version of Acrobat to enabled the documents and recent versions of Reader to work with them.

    The Base line version is 10.1.4.1.0, all others are patches. The latest being 10.1.4.3.0, which can be downloaded via MOS (formerly known as Metalink).
    10G release 3 is marketing speak; 10.1.4.1 thru 10.1.4.3 are all 10G Release 3 (but different patchlevels. Guess you can speak of OID 10G release 3 patch 2, when you mean OID V10.1.4.3.0 - technicians tend to use versions).

    iWork (no "s") is not an application, but the name given to the package of two applications, Keynote & Pages.
    Keynote is a presentation application that can open AppleWorks 6 presentation files & PowerPoint files. I haven't use Keynote other than to view a few presentation. You probably can find a lot of information by searching the Keynote forum.
    Pages is the word processing/page layout application in iWork. Pages is able to open AppleWorks 6 word processing document as well as Word, text & RTF documents. It is not able to open any other AppleWorks documents or older Word documents (I'm not sure how far back it goes). Pages 1 (iWork '05) will not display floating spreadsheet frames in AppleWorks 6 word processing documents, Pages 2 can. Pages 2 has limited spreadsheet functions available in tables (as does Keynote 3, both in iWork '06). Pages can export as PDF, Word, plain text, RTF & HTML (HTML export is disappointing to say the least). It cannot export as AppleWorks (any version).
    No one here knows for sure if AppleWorks will ever get another update & those that do have signed non-disclosure agreements, but it is extremely unlikely. In the iWork ’05 press release iWork is said to be "building the successor to AppleWorks."
    Many users here, like me, use Pages for what it does so well & AppleWorks for what it does that iWork doesn't (at least not yet) - databases, spreadsheets & drawing.

    Is there any reason to use a button name like "My_Button" rather than "My Button" in DVDSP?
    No, this is not required. In fact Apple use names for buttons in their templates like "Button 1" , "Button 2" et c.
    The only reason to name things "Button_1" with an underscore, or "Button1" without a space, is if you like following Unix naming conventions - where spaces aren't possible. This is (quite) useful for files and folders, so that the actual underlying Unix filename is the same as the name that mac OS X displays.
    I have a book on the subject ...
    The author of your book probably likes to use traditional computer naming conventions for everything, so won't use spaces. Personally I think there's no harm in not using spaces when naming elements "Menu1", "Track1", "Button1" et c. But it is a matter of personal preference.
